    Your 2010 Hall of Fame Ballot

    No professional sport's Hall of Fame leads to such intense debate as Baseball's annual induction. It turns husbands against wives, fathers against sons, everyone against Jon Heyman, and so on.

    This year's ballot has some interesting new comers. Last year the only new name on the ballot to receive induction was Rickey Henderson. Two players tallied over 60% of the vote, Dawson and Blyleven, as they inch closer to Cooperstown. I don't have an official vote, obviously, but I give a lot of thought to this subject each year. If I had a vote though, I would select the following:

    Bert Blyleven
    Alan Trammell
    Edgar Martinez
    Roberto Alomar
    Barry Larkin
    Tim Raines

    All players need to total at least 75% of the vote to receive induction. Whom does the rest of the OS Community feel deserves induction?

        Re: Your 2010 Hall of Fame Ballot

        Alomar and Larkin for me.

        Edgar Martinez probably should get in but won't, at least not as a first ballot. It may take a few more years before voters are willing to accept DH as a position (which is why Harold Baines will not be getting in either).
